Gaultheria procumbens 'Peppermint Pearl' Wintergreen Teaberry

Gaultheria procumbens

'Peppermint Pearl'

Wintergreen Teaberry

Zones 3-11

Partial Shade or Full Shade

'Peppermint Pearl' is a low growing shade evergreen. 'Peppermint Pearl' has green leaves in the spring and the fall, turning to red in the fall. 'Peppermint Pearl' has bell-shaped white flowers in the summer that develop into pearl white berries that turn a nice peppermint pink. The berries provide a great interest from winter through winter. 'Peppermint Pearl' may reach 8 inches in height by 3 ft in width in 10 years. This makes an excellent groundcover or container plant.
